Latest Patents
One of his latest patents is focused on temperature-controlled induction heating of polymeric materials. This invention introduces a new polymer induction bonding technology that utilizes induction heating to weld, forge, bond, or set polymer materials. By incorporating ferromagnetic particles into the polymer, the invention allows for controlled-temperature induction heating. The ferromagnetic particles heat up in an induction field until they reach their specific Curie temperature, at which point heat generation ceases. This technology is applicable for bonding thermoplastic materials, curing thermoset adhesives, and consolidating thermoplastic composites. Another notable patent involves compositions produced by solvent exchange methods, which include coatings, films, and articles of manufacture derived from a mixture that includes water and optionally substituted thiophene. This patent also covers methods for making and using these innovative materials, including their electro-optical applications.
